I am using Opencart Version 2.3.0.2.

My site was earlier hosted on godaddy server. Few days back I moved my site to Google cloud platform. Everything went smoothly but on the new server all the pages that does not have right column contents show very unusual results. Like for e.g. on Products Category page, there is no right column, but it still shows empty space by reducing width of center column. Same for About, Contact and other pages.. However the Home page shows just fine.
